>>> Sorry for the delay. I ran my simple stress test against the patch set and
>>> saw no issues. For the record it is by no means a thorough regression, but it
>>> has illuminated issues in the past.
>> Thanks for your testing.
>>> The test itself uses a "heartbeat" module in the SCP firmware that generates
>>> notifications at a programmable interval. The stress test is simply generating
>>> these heartbeats (SCP to AP notifications) while also generating protocol version
>>> queries (AP to SCP). The notifications are sequence numbered to verify none are
>>> lost, however SCP to AP notification support does not support SCP generating
>>> notifications faster than the AP can process them, so the heartbeat rate must be
>>> reasonably slow (on the order of 10s of millliseconds).
>> I understand your concern. I think this doesn't get int the way of what we
>> are doing.
>>
>> My stress tests were also run in type3 and type4 concurrent scenarios.
>> There were two drivers using type3 to send command looply on platform.
>> In the firmware terminal window,
>> there were two channels for type4 to generate notifications from platform at
>> the 1ms(even shorter) interval.
>> I didn't find anything issues in this stress after running a couple of
>> hours.
